It is National Celiac Awareness Month, so we thought we’d celebrate it by featuring a cruelty-free, vegan makeup that is also gluten free. It stands to reason that those who are intolerant to ingested gluten also don’t want to have gluten on their bodies, but gluten is found as an ingredient in many commercial makeup lines. Even the cleanest, organic makeup can cause skin issues to someone with gluten intolerance if the makeup contains gluten ingredients!

What makes Lilywhite Organics vegan beauty products different from the rest is that, where others use water, they use 100% aloe vera juice. Aloe vera juice is excellent for the skin, with many benefits including reducing wound healing time, reducing inflammation and stimulating growth of new tissue. Additionally Lilywhite Organics points out that, unlike water, aloe has over 75 vitamins and nutrients.

We absolutely love it when we come across vegan, cruelty-free makeup brushes. We are often surprised when we find companies that boast about their vegan cosmetics, but then sell makeup brushes that contain animal fur. Many people believe that the fur is simply cut off of the animal, but in many cases it is fur that is considered too poor quality for clothing. In cases when it is simply trimmed off of the animal, such as horse hair tools, there is no reliable way of knowing the life that the animals lead.
